Research: Performance and Stability of Amine-Functionalised Metal-Organic Frameworks for Post-Combustion CO2 Capture

Research question: How do different amine-functionalised metal-organic frameworks compare in terms of CO2 adsorption capacity, selectivity, and long-term stability under simulated flue gas conditions?

Metal-organic frameworks (MOFs) functionalised with amine groups have emerged as promising materials for the selective capture of CO2 from industrial emissions, due to their tunable pore structures and chemical versatility. Post-combustion CO2 capture remains a critical challenge for mitigating greenhouse gas emissions from power plants and heavy industry.

Despite substantial research, comparative data on the adsorption performance and long-term chemical stability of various amine-functionalised MOFs under realistic flue gas conditions is limited. Key parameters such as cyclic stability, moisture resistance, and regeneration energy requirements are not systematically understood.

This project will synthesise and characterise several amine-functionalised MOFs (e.g., mmen-Mg2(dobpdc), UiO-66-NH2) and evaluate their CO2 adsorption capacity, selectivity over N2, and stability across multiple cycles under humidified gas mixtures. Experimental data will be complemented by isotherm modelling and spectroscopic analysis to elucidate adsorption mechanisms.

Understanding the performance and degradation pathways of these materials will inform the design of more robust and efficient CO2 capture systems, supporting the development of scalable carbon management technologies.

Milestones
1. Literature Review & Problem Definition
15 marks 20d
Survey recent advances in amine-functionalised MOFs for CO2 capture, identify gaps, and refine the research focus.
2. Research Proposal & Hypotheses
10 marks 14d
Develop a detailed proposal specifying materials, hypotheses, and experimental objectives.
3. Methodology & Experimental Design
15 marks 18d
Design synthesis protocols, adsorption tests, stability assessments, and select analytic techniques.
4. Data Collection / Experimentation
25 marks 28d
Synthesize materials, conduct CO2/N2 adsorption measurements, and perform cyclic stability tests under humid conditions.
5. Analysis & Results
20 marks 24d
Interpret adsorption isotherms, compare material performance, and analyse structural changes post-cycling.
6. Thesis Write-up & Defense
15 marks 18d
Compile results, draft and revise the thesis, and prepare for oral defense.
